Embodiment 1
[0034] Such as figure 1 As shown, the anti-seepage oil noise reduction assembly provided by the embodiment of the present invention includes: a perforated part 100, a noise reduction box 200, and a sound-absorbing part 300; box 200 , and there is a gap between the punching part 100 and the sound-absorbing part 300 .
[0035] Specifically, the sound-absorbing member 300 may use noise-reducing cotton, the noise-reducing box 200 may be an integrally formed part, and the noise-reducing cotton is installed in the inner cavity of the noise-reducing box 200 . The anti-seepage oil noise reduction component can be used to reduce the noise of the range hood. There is a gap between the perforated part 100 and the sound-absorbing part 300, which can reduce the probability of the oil passing through the perforated part 100 contacting the sound-absorbing part 300, thereby reducing the absorption of the sound-absorbing part 300. Embodiment 2
[0056] Such as figure 1 with Figure 8 As shown, the range hood provided by the embodiment of the present invention includes: a chassis 500, a fan assembly 600 and the anti-seepage oil noise reduction assembly provided in Embodiment 1; the fan assembly 600 is installed in the chassis 500, and the noise reduction box 200 is installed in the chassis The side opening of 500, the sound absorbing part 300 is located between the sound absorbing part 300 and the fan assembly 600.
[0057] Specifically, the noise reduction box 200 is provided with a convex hull 203, and the convex hull 203 is clamped on the side wall of the chassis 500. The noise reduction box 200 is flush with the outer surface of the side wall of the chassis 500, so that the outer cover can be installed more smoothly.
